A new way of life

I am 6 and a half months out. I can run around all day or just sit in a chair for 12 hours I will still have the same swelly belly at night time. When I know I am going out and want to look and feel good. I stop eatting at 2 because right after dinner I swell up no matter what I eat. I do not swell up because of the gym work out.

I bend at night and can feel my belly press againtest my breasts. I read a post here saying it had been a few years since her operation and still at night she is 2 inches bigger than in the AM.

This is my life now I guess, I have had all the tests. I have to come to terms with my new belly. I hate it, I spend alot of time working out before my TAH I wasn't a size 4 but now at a size 12 or 14 I feel robbed of my body. I still work out but I notice how different my belly feels on certain machines.

I have waited almost 7 months for this swelly belly to go away. I have to realize it won't. And God knows I have tried everything.

Janet TAH BSO
